E3 2015: Bethesda Unveils New Apps for The Elder Scrolls, Fallout 4

Bethesda has unveiled its upcoming collectible card game, as well as a mobile companion app for Fallout 4.

At its E3 2015 showcase event, game developer Bethesda greatly embraced mobile platforms, announcing three new titles for both smartphones and tablets. On top of the announcement and release of Fallout Shelter on iOS devices, Bethesda revealed The Elder Scrolls Legends and a Fallout 4 companion app.

First, The Elder Scrolls Legends is the developer’s take on the strategy card genre, which has recently been dominated by the likes of Blizzard’s Hearthstone.
